Dimension 1: The Spec Sheet vs. The Actual Machine

This is where the rubber meets the road—or where the laser beam hits the material.

Power Output & Consistency

Generic Brand: Advertises "40W CO2 Laser." More often than not, this is peak power, not operational power. In 2022, we tested a batch where the "40W" units averaged 32-35W under sustained load. The cooling system couldn't keep up, so power dropped during longer jobs. The vendor's response? "Within industry tolerance." (Which, honestly, is a phrase I've come to distrust.)

Monport Laser: Also advertises 40W. In our verification (using a laser power meter, as of April 2024), the Monport 40W CO2 laser held between 38-40W across a one-hour continuous run. The difference? Their specs tend to reflect mean operational power, not a theoretical peak. The product page usually details the laser tube brand (like RECI) which lets you verify the component's own specs.

Contrast Insight: "40W" isn't a universal standard. With generics, you're usually buying the possibility of 40W. With Monport, you're closer to buying a guarantee of it. For precision work on laser cut plans that demand consistent depth, this isn't a small detail.

Construction & Safety Features

Generic Brand: The frame might be aluminum, but the joints and panels often feel... insubstantial. Safety features are typically minimal: a basic door switch and maybe a removable key. I've seen interlocks that could be easily bypassed with a piece of tape (a huge red flag).

Monport Laser: The construction is noticeably more robust. Their desktop models, like those in the best 20W laser engraver category, use thicker aluminum and steel composites. Safety is a bigger focus: proper interlocks that kill power when opened, integrated ventilation ports, and clearer warning labels that actually meet basic regulatory guidance (per ANSI Z136.1 for laser safety).

The Unexpected Conclusion: Here's the surprising part. The core laser cutter CNC machine mechanics (steppers, rails) can be quite similar. The real divergence is in the housing, wiring, and safety systems. Monport spends money where the generic brand often doesn't: on the parts that don't directly make the cut but prevent catastrophe.

Dimension 2: The Unboxing & First 72 Hours

This phase separates a tool from a project.

Setup & Documentation

Generic Brand: You'll get a PDF manual that reads like it was translated through three languages. The wiring diagram might be blurry. The software is usually a cracked or ancient version of something like LaserGRBL, delivered on a CD-R (no, really).

Monport Laser: The documentation is a step up. It's not perfect (I've found missing steps), but it's coherent. They provide links to current software downloads—often LightBurn, which is industry-standard. Their YouTube channel has setup videos for specific models. It's not foolproof, but it shows an intent to support the setup process.

Initial Support & Responsiveness

Generic Brand: Support is a gamble. You might get an email response in 48 hours from someone who clearly doesn't own the machine. Troubleshooting is scripted: "Check all connections. Reinstall software." If you need a part, you're often directed to AliExpress with a product ID.

Monport Laser: This is their tangible advantage. They have U.S.-based support staff (not just sales). Response time is usually within a few hours for technical issues. More importantly, they have parts inventory in the U.S. for common failures. When our 60W's lens assembly got damaged, they shipped a replacement from a Nevada warehouse in two days. The generic supplier quoted 4-6 weeks from Shenzhen.

In our Q3 2023 vendor test, the Monport support query resolved a firmware issue in 90 minutes. The generic brand's "solution" was to send a new controller board... with no instructions on how to install it. The downtime cost wasn't in the initial price.

Dimension 3: The Long-Term Cost of Ownership

The price tag is the first cost. It's rarely the last.

Parts, Consumables, & Upgrades

Generic Brand: Mirrors, lenses, and laser tubes are generic. You can find them cheaply, but quality varies wildly. A $50 replacement tube might last 6 months. A "compatible" lens might scatter the beam, ruining edge quality. You become your own parts engineer.

Monport Laser: They sell OEM-spec parts. A replacement RECI tube for a Monport machine is more expensive upfront. But it's the correct part, with predictable performance and lifespan (typically 1-2 years of normal use). Their upgrade paths are clearer—moving from a 40W to a 60W tube in the same chassis is usually a documented option.

Resale Value & Community

This is the hidden factor few consider upfront.
Generic Brand: Has no resale value. It's a "mystery box" machine. There's no brand recognition, no community forum where users share settings for specific materials.
Monport Laser: Holds value. Because it's a known entity with support, a used Monport laser sells for 50-70% of its new price on forums or Facebook Marketplace. There are user groups where people share Monport laser discount code findings, material settings, and mods. That community knowledge is a massive asset when you're stuck.

Professional Boundary Admission: I'll be honest. Monport isn't a universal laser company. If you need a 5kW industrial fiber laser for cutting 1-inch steel plate, they're not your vendor (and they don't pretend to be). They specialize in the light-industrial, small shop, and prosumer space (CO2 and fiber up to a few hundred watts). That focus is why their support and ecosystem work for that niche.

So, Which One Should You Choose? (It Depends.)

Here’s my practical, scene-by-scene advice, based on watching these machines operate in the wild.

Choose a Generic Brand IF:

  • You are a confident tinkerer. You see the machine as a starting point, not a finished product. You're comfortable sourcing parts, debugging electrical issues, and don't mind downtime.
  • Your budget is absolute and upfront cost is everything. You need a laser, any laser, to start testing a concept. The risk of it being a paperweight is an acceptable gamble for the lower entry price.
  • Your projects are non-critical. You're engraving gifts, doing occasional signage. If it's down for two weeks, no business income is lost.

To be fair, for the right person, a generic machine is a powerful learning tool and can be made reliable with enough personal investment.

Choose Monport Laser IF:

  • You run a business. Time is money. A machine that works out of the box, with accessible support and predictable parts, reduces risk. The higher initial price is an insurance policy against downtime.
  • You value consistency. You need to produce the same engraving depth or cut quality on job 1 and job 100. The tighter tolerances and brand-name components support repeatability.
  • You're not an engineer. You want to focus on using the laser, not maintaining it. You want to search "Monport 40W CO2 laser acrylic settings" and find a usable answer from another owner.
  • You think long-term. You might upgrade power, sell the machine in a few years, or scale. The ecosystem and brand recognition have tangible future value.
